Step-by-Step Installation Process
1. Prepare the Garage Door
Before you begin the installation, be certain that the storage door is fully closed and the ability supply is turned off. This prevents any unintentional activation whilst you work. Check the door for any obstructions and clear away any particles within the immediate area.
2. Measure and Mark the Sensor Placement
Using a tape measure, determine the place to position the security sensors. They must be mounted on either facet of the storage door, about 6 inches above the ground. Proper alignment is essential for these sensors to function correctly.

3. Install the Sensors
Using a drill, connect the sensors to the garage door track or the wall. Make positive they are degree and securely fixed. It’s advisable to test the steadiness before proceeding. 4. Connect the Wires
Once the sensors are installed, you’ll need to attach them with the suitable wires to the garage door opener. This often entails stripping the wire and connecting it to the corresponding terminals on the opener unit - Expert Garage Door Alignment Services Morinville. Use electrical tape to secure the connections for safety

5. Test the System
After every little thing is related, restore energy to the storage door opener and conduct a take a look at. Close the door after which put an object within the path of the door. The door ought to reverse upon sensing the obstruction. This take a look at is vital to guarantee that the sensors perform properly, providing the mandatory safety you anticipate.
Common Issues and Troubleshooting
Sometimes, even after set up, garage door safety sensors could not work as supposed. Here are some common points and solutions:
- **Misaligned Sensors:** Check if the sensors are stage and going through each other. A slight adjustment would possibly resolve the difficulty. **Debris Blockage:** Ensure there are no leaves, filth, or cobwebs obstructing the sensors' path. **Wiring Problems:** Inspect the wiring for any signs of harm or free connections. Reconnect if essential. **Failing Sensors:** If the sensors are damaged, replacing them may be necessary. Consult with a local garage door repair specialist if wanted.
